The Ghent Altarpiece

Jan van Eyck · 1432 · St Bavo Cathedral, Ghent
The Ghent Altarpiece

The artist

Jan van Eyck, a master painter from the Low Countries who was famous for his amazing, glowing details.

What you see

A huge painting made of many panels that fold open like a giant book, full of angels, people, and a peaceful lamb.

The story

Van Eyck and his brother finished this great altarpiece in 1432 for a cathedral, and it is still treasured today.

The style

He used oil paints to show tiny details, from sparkling jewels to single hairs, so everything looks real and shiny.

Look closer

When the panels are open, you can count many green plants and flowers, each one painted like a real garden.

Where to see it

You can see it in Saint Bavo's Cathedral in the city of Ghent, in Belgium, where it has stayed for centuries.

Fun fact

This painting has quite an adventure story, as it was stolen and hidden many times but always came back home.
